
Looking for a new and exciting way to liven up your next gathering? Dive into "Which one of us?"—a free, fun-filled party game designed to bring you and your friends closer together through a series of engaging and revealing questions. Imagine asking, "Which one of us gets drunk first at the party?" or "Which one of us is more afraid of death?" Maybe you're curious about "Which of us is more touchy?" or daring enough to ask, "Who will go out in public without a bra?" This game is your ticket to uncovering what your friends truly think about you, and vice versa. Get ready to discover some surprising truths about your circle, even the ones you might not be eager to hear.
All it takes is gathering your friends at a party and placing the game on the table. The game comes with a deck of 250 cards, each prompting a question that promises laughter and revelations. The rules are simple: one player draws a card and reads the question aloud. After a brief 2-3 seconds for everyone to ponder, on the count of "three," all players point to the person they believe best fits the question. Is it the friend who always sheds tears during melodramas or the one who panics at the sight of insects?
What follows is an emotional discussion, filled with stories and anecdotes from everyone's lives. Through this game, you'll gain a clearer picture of how your friends perceive you and perhaps learn who among you has had an unexpected brush with the law, like being handcuffed.
